Transaction 89963ce9eb852ae9b20a8c9712a9f36dbd999fbaeea589c920aa60be61148439
1 Input
1 Output
-
89963ce9eb852ae9b20a8c9712a9f36dbd999fbaeea589c920aa60be61148439: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 31b8d8952312fa5ee5e2c8e1bfe24ecb8d64ca6d5b2f5f458da323fd20e27490
- address
- bc1pxxud39frzta9ae0zersmlcjwewxkfjndtvh473vd5v3l6g8zwjgq4crcyd